mucocutaneous
/ˌmjuːkoʊkjuːˈteɪniəs/
adjective
- Relating to or affecting both mucous membranes and the skin.
- Certain viruses can cause mucocutaneous lesions that appear on the lips and inside the mouth.
- Mucocutaneous symptoms often include sores where the skin meets the lining of the body openings.
- The doctor explained that the rash was a mucocutaneous reaction to the medication.
